Current Status of the Effect of Seawater Ions on Copper Flotation: Difficulties, Opportunities, and Industrial Experience
Mineral Processing and Extractive Metallurgy Review ( IF 5 ) Pub Date : 2021-03-18 , DOI: 10.1080/08827508.2021.1900175
Constanza Cruz 1, 2 , Yesica. L. Botero 1, 3 , Ricardo I. Jeldres 1 , Lina Uribe 4 , Luis A. Cisternas 1
Affiliation  

ABSTRACT

The limited availability of conventional water resources and inefficient water management has resulted in seawater use in the flotation process of copper sulfide ores at several concentrator plants. The flotation process in seawater is complex and multifaceted, as its chemistry is different compared to fresh water. This article presents the current status of the effect of seawater ions on flotation of copper sulfides ores, aiming to identify the main difficulties and opportunities related to this issue. This article also presents the current industrial experience of the flotation of copper sulfide ores with seawater and possible solutions to improve their performance.
